Understanding AUTOSAR
AUTOSAR, or Automotive Open System Architecture, is a global development partnership of automotive interested parties founded in 2003.
Its primary aim is to create and establish a standard architecture for automotive software.
Through cooperation between multiple stakeholders in the industry, AUTOSAR has become a fundamental aspect of in-vehicle networking systems.
This adaptive standard strives to improve efficiency and safety, focusing on the reuse of software, scalable software architecture, and the integration of diverse systems.

Components of AUTOSAR-Compliant Systems
Understanding the core components of AUTOSAR is essential for comprehending its overall impact on automotive systems.
Basic Software
The basic software, or BSW, includes essential services and interfaces that support application software in vehicles.
It comprises various layers, ranging from microcontroller drivers to services layer, each serving specific functions like communication management or real-time operating systems.
Runtime Environment (RTE)
RTE acts as a middleman between application software components and the basic software modules.
It manages communication, ensuring seamless interaction among the components, and provides the necessary abstraction that allows software reuse across different hardware environments.
Application Software
This includes the functionalities tailored to meet specific customer requirements, such as body control, engine management, or infotainment systems.
AUTOSAR provides a framework for developing these applications, making them compatible with the underlying architecture.
In-Vehicle Networks
The AUTOSAR standard also impacts how in-vehicle networks are designed and utilized.
Importance of In-Vehicle Networks
In-vehicle networks are the backbone of modern automotive systems, enabling communication between electronic control units (ECUs), sensors, and actuators.
They support various applications, from safety systems to user interfaces.
With AUTOSAR, these networks follow standardized communication protocols, which simplifies the integration process and ensures reliability.
Key Network Protocols
Several network protocols play a vital role in AUTOSAR-compliant systems.
CAN (Controller Area Network)
CAN is a robust protocol commonly used in automotive networks due to its simplicity and reliability.
It supports real-time data transfer and is efficient for short message lengths, making it suitable for controlling various vehicle functions.
LIN (Local Interconnect Network)
LIN is a lower-cost alternative to CAN, often used for simpler applications in vehicles, such as controlling non-critical systems like air conditioning or seat positioning.
Ethernet
Ethernet is becoming increasingly significant in automotive environments due to its high-speed data transfer capabilities.
It is ideal for demanding applications like multimedia streaming or advanced driver-assistance systems.
Security Measures in AUTOSAR
With the increasing connectivity of vehicles, security has become a paramount concern in AUTOSAR-compliant systems.
Threats to In-Vehicle Networks
As vehicles incorporate more digital connectivity, they become potential targets for cyberattacks.
These threats can range from unauthorized access to critical systems to compromising data integrity.
Strategies for Enhancing Security
AUTOSAR addresses these concerns through various security measures and strategies.
Secure Communication
Implementing secure communication protocols ensures data integrity and prevents unauthorized access.
For example, encrypting messages exchanged between ECUs can safeguard the network from potential threats.
Authentication
Authentication mechanisms verify the legitimacy of devices and users accessing the vehicle’s network.
By ensuring only authorized parties interact with the system, the risk of malicious activity is minimized.
Intrusion Detection
Intrusion detection systems (IDS) continuously monitor the network for abnormal activity or unauthorized access attempts.
These systems help identify potential threats and allow for timely responses to prevent damage.
